The debate between IPv4 and IPv6 differences is critical in understanding the evolution of networking protocols. With the Internet’s rapid growth, IP addressing has become increasingly significant for connectivity and communication.
Notably, IPv4, with its limited address space, faces challenges in accommodating the burgeoning number of devices. In contrast, IPv6 promises an extensive addressing framework, addressing both current and future networking demands.
Understanding the Basics of IPv4 and IPv6
IPv4 and IPv6 are two distinct internet protocols that dictate how devices communicate over networks. IPv4, established in the early 1980s, utilizes 32-bit addresses, allowing for approximately 4.3 billion unique IP addresses. This limitation has become increasingly problematic due to the exponential growth of internet-connected devices.
In contrast, IPv6 was developed to address the shortcomings of IPv4, providing a vastly larger address space through 128-bit addresses. This expansion results in an almost limitless number of unique IP addresses, enabling networks to accommodate the ongoing proliferation of devices and services.
Understanding the fundamentals of these protocols is vital for grasping their differences, particularly in the context of networking protocols. IPv4 relies on methods such as Network Address Translation (NAT) to manage address scarcity, while IPv6, with its extensive address space, aims to mitigate or eliminate the need for such workarounds.
As the internet continues to evolve, the transition from IPv4 to IPv6 is essential for sustaining growth and innovation. This transition highlights the urgency of understanding the differences between IPv4 and IPv6, as network performance and security become increasingly reliant on these protocols.
Technical Structure: IPv4 vs IPv6 Differences
IPv4 and IPv6 exhibit notable differences in their technical structure, primarily characterized by their address length and format. IPv4 addresses, composed of a 32-bit format, yield approximately 4.3 billion unique addresses, though the actual usable count is lower due to reserved addresses. IPv6, in contrast, utilizes a 128-bit format, resulting in a staggering number of potential addresses, surpassing 340 undecillion.
The address format further highlights the distinctions. IPv4 addresses appear in a dotted-decimal notation, such as 192.168.1.1, while IPv6 addresses employ a hexadecimal format separated by colons, exemplified by 2001:0db8:85a3:0000:0000:8a2e:0370:7334. This change improves readability and efficiency in address allocation.
Moreover, the complexity of the header structure differs significantly between the protocols. The IPv4 header is less efficient due to its size and the necessity for various options. IPv6 simplifies this by eliminating several fields, thus enhancing processing efficiency. These technical structures illustrate the evolving needs in networking, highlighting the IPv4 vs IPv6 differences.
Address Length
In the context of IPv4 vs IPv6 differences, address length serves as a fundamental distinction between the two protocols. IPv4 utilizes a 32-bit address scheme, allowing for a total of approximately 4.3 billion unique addresses. This limitation is significant in a world that increasingly relies on internet connectivity.
Conversely, IPv6 employs a 128-bit address format, which expands the potential address space to an astounding 340 undecillion unique addresses. This massive scale not only accommodates current devices but also anticipates future growth in networked technology and the Internet of Things (IoT).
The implications of this disparity in address length are profound. While IPv4 has led to the implementation of techniques like Network Address Translation (NAT) to manage the limited address space, IPv6 aims to eliminate such constraints entirely, offering a more straightforward addressing scheme.
Ultimately, the differences in address length between IPv4 and IPv6 highlight the evolving needs of network management and the necessity for a robust addressing framework to keep pace with technological advancements.
Address Format
The address format represents a fundamental difference between IPv4 and IPv6. IPv4 addresses are 32-bits in length, expressed in decimal format as four octets separated by periods (e.g., 192.168.1.1). In contrast, IPv6 addresses utilize a 128-bit length, displayed in hexadecimal notation with eight groups of four hexadecimal digits separated by colons (e.g., 2001:0db8:85a3:0000:0000:8a2e:0370:7334).
The structure of these formats underscores significant differences in usability and complexity. IPv4’s simpler notation makes it easier for humans to read and write, whereas IPv6’s length and format provide more addressable space, accommodating the exponential growth of devices connected to the internet.
IPv6 also includes a mechanism for compressing the address notation, enabling shorter representations by omitting leading zeros and using double colons to indicate consecutive groups of zeros. This flexibility showcases the modern design of IPv6 in contrast to the more straightforward yet limited structure of IPv4.
The differences in address format reflect broader implications for networking and connectivity, reinforcing the necessity of transitioning from IPv4 to IPv6 as the demand for unique IP addresses continues to surge.
Address Space and Capacity
IPv4 and IPv6 differ significantly in terms of address space and capacity. IPv4 utilizes a 32-bit address scheme, which allows for approximately 4.3 billion unique addresses. However, this finite number has led to exhaustion due to the explosive growth of devices connected to the Internet.
In contrast, IPv6 employs a 128-bit address system, resulting in an astronomical potential for unique addresses, totaling around 340 undecillion. This expanded capacity aims to accommodate the increasing number of internet-connected devices, ensuring a sustainable addressing solution for the future.
With IPv6, organizations can allocate multiple addresses to a single device, facilitating the seamless integration of IoT (Internet of Things) devices and smart technologies. This capacity alleviates the need for complex NAT solutions, which are often required in IPv4 networks.
Overall, understanding the address space and capacity differences between IPv4 and IPv6 highlights the necessity for transitioning to IPv6, emphasizing its role in meeting contemporary and future networking demands.
Header Complexity and Efficiency
The header structure in IPv4 and IPv6 exhibits notable differences in complexity and efficiency. IPv4, with its 20-byte header, includes various fields such as version, header length, type of service, and options, which contribute to its complexity. Conversely, IPv6 simplifies this structure with a fixed 40-byte header designed to streamline processing.
Key attributes revealing IPv4 vs IPv6 differences in header complexity include:
- Field Reduction: IPv6 reduces optional fields, enhancing efficiency in data processing.
- Flow Label: The addition of the flow label in IPv6 aids in managing packet flows, optimizing routing.
- Extensions: While IPv4 requires additional headers for specific features, IPv6 allocates this through extension headers, improving flexibility without overcrowding the essential header.
This simplified header in IPv6 not only minimizes mistakes during packet routing but also enables faster processing by networking devices. Consequently, the design allows for more efficient handling of modern internet traffic, reflecting a significant shift in networking protocols as they evolve to accommodate increased data and connectivity demands.
Security Features: IPv4 and IPv6
IPv4 and IPv6 differ significantly in their security features, reflecting the evolution of network protocols over time. While IPv4 lacks comprehensive built-in security mechanisms, it relies on external protocols such as IPsec to provide encryption and authentication. This reliance can lead to vulnerabilities as the configuration of these protocols is not inherently enforced.
In contrast, IPv6 incorporates IPsec as a fundamental element, mandating its support for secure communication. This built-in security framework simplifies the process of establishing secure connections and enhances overall network security. The mandatory nature of IPsec in IPv6 promotes a more consistent implementation across different devices and networks.
While IPv6 greatly improves security, it does not eliminate the risks associated with cyber threats. Both IPv4 and IPv6 networks must implement robust security policies, including firewalls and intrusion detection systems. Therefore, understanding the security features in the context of IPv4 vs IPv6 differences is vital for network administrators and organizations.
Built-in Security in IPv6
IPv6 incorporates several built-in security features, fundamentally enhancing the security landscape of networking protocols. One notable aspect is the mandatory implementation of Internet Protocol Security (IPsec), which provides confidentiality, integrity, and authenticity for data packets, enabling secure communications across networks.
With IPsec, IPv6 ensures that all devices can benefit from standardized encryption algorithms, which can safeguard data transmissions against various cyber threats. This feature contrasts with IPv4, where IPsec is optional, leading to inconsistent security practices across different networks.
Another significant enhancement in IPv6 is its support for secure neighbor discovery protocols. This prevents risks associated with neighbor discovery attacks, which are commonplace in IPv4 environments. Such vulnerabilities can lead to address spoofing and unauthorized access, making the built-in security features of IPv6 even more critical.
Overall, these security enhancements in IPv6 not only provide a stronger defense against potential threats but also simplify the approach to securing communications, streamlining the transition from IPv4 and its inherent vulnerabilities.
Security Protocols for IPv4
Security protocols for IPv4 are essential for ensuring the integrity and confidentiality of data transmitted over networks. Despite its age, IPv4 employs several security protocols, most notably IPsec, which provides end-to-end encryption and authenticity for data exchanges.
IPsec operates at the network layer, allowing it to secure all traffic between compatible devices. It offers two modes: transport mode, which encrypts only the payload, and tunnel mode, which encrypts the entire packet. Implementing IPsec enhances communication security but often requires significant configuration efforts.
Apart from IPsec, other security protocols, such as Secure Sockets Layer (SSL) and Transport Layer Security (TLS), are commonly used in conjunction with IPv4. These protocols protect data during transmission by creating an encrypted link between clients and servers, ensuring safe transactions, particularly in web communications.
While IPv4 offers these security mechanisms, they are not inherently built into the protocol. Instead, organizations must actively implement these protocols to mitigate risks, highlighting a critical difference when comparing IPv4 vs IPv6 differences.
Network Address Translation (NAT) Usage
Network Address Translation (NAT) is a method used in networking that modifies IP address information in the packet headers while in transit across a traffic routing device. This technique is particularly relevant for connecting multiple devices to the internet using a single public IP address, effectively managing address scarcity.
In the context of IPv4, NAT has become a widespread solution due to the limited address space available. By employing NAT, organizations can internally assign private IP addresses, conserving public IP addresses while still allowing devices to communicate with external networks. This has led to increased flexibility in network management.
Conversely, with the advent of IPv6, the necessity for NAT diminishes significantly. The vast address space available with IPv6 allows for unique public IP addresses for each device, reducing the complications associated with address translation. Consequently, the shift toward IPv6 is expected to fundamentally alter NAT usage in future networking landscapes.
The transition from IPv4 to IPv6 presents a significant shift in how networks operate and manage IP addresses. While NAT remains a crucial solution for IPv4, its role may decline with the increased adoption of IPv6.
Compatibility and Transition Mechanisms
The transition from IPv4 to IPv6 has necessitated the development of various compatibility and transition mechanisms due to the fundamental differences between the two protocols. Effective communication between IPv4 and IPv6 networks is critical as the global internet infrastructure evolves.
Several strategies have emerged to ensure seamless interoperability during this transition, including:
- Dual Stack: This mechanism allows devices to operate with both IPv4 and IPv6 addresses simultaneously, ensuring compatibility with both protocols.
- Tunneling: This technique encapsulates IPv6 packets within IPv4 packets, allowing IPv6 traffic to traverse an IPv4 infrastructure.
- Translation: Protocol translation services convert IPv6 packets to IPv4 packets and vice versa, enabling communication between networks that use different IP versions.
These mechanisms support gradual adoption, minimizing disruptions as organizations shift towards IPv6. Understanding these compatibility strategies is vital when exploring the broader context of IPv4 vs IPv6 differences.
Adoption Rates and Industry Trends
The transition from IPv4 to IPv6 is gaining significant traction across various sectors. Adoption rates for IPv6 have steadily increased as organizations recognize its necessity to accommodate the expanding number of internet-connected devices. Statistics indicate that as of 2023, approximately 40% of global internet users are accessing the web via IPv6.
Industry trends reflect a growing awareness of IPv6’s benefits. Major tech companies, including Google and Facebook, are leading the way in implementing IPv6, driving a shift in infrastructure development. This transition directly correlates with the ever-increasing demand for IP addresses as the Internet of Things (IoT) continues to proliferate.
Several factors are influencing adoption rates and industry trends, including:
- Desire for enhanced security features inherent in IPv6.
- The exhaustion of available IPv4 addresses.
- The increased efficiency and performance of networks utilizing IPv6.
As more organizations adopt IPv6, the networking landscape is expected to evolve, promoting a more robust and interconnected digital environment.
The Future of IP Addressing: Embracing IPv6
As the demand for Internet-connected devices continues to rise, the limitations of IPv4 become increasingly evident. IPv6 addresses this challenge by providing a virtually limitless pool of IP addresses. This transition is vital for supporting an expanding array of devices in the Internet of Things (IoT) landscape.
Adopting IPv6 enhances network efficiency and facilitates direct communication between devices without relying on Network Address Translation (NAT). This streamlined communication reduces latency and complexity, making processes more efficient and improving overall performance.
The growing emphasis on security in networking further solidifies the importance of transitioning to IPv6. With built-in security features, including IPsec, IPv6 offers an enhanced framework for data protection. This capability is critical as cyber threats evolve and require more sophisticated security measures.
Organizations and service providers are increasingly recognizing these benefits, prompting a gradual shift towards IPv6 adoption. As they embrace this new protocol, the future of IP addressing is set to transform, paving the way for a more connected and secure digital environment.
As the debate on IPv4 vs IPv6 differences continues, it is essential to recognize the pressing need for a transition toward IPv6. The imminent exhaustion of IPv4 addresses necessitates the adoption of IPv6 for future-proofing the Internet.
Understanding the fundamental distinctions between these protocols enables organizations and individuals to make informed networking decisions. Embracing IPv6 is not just a technical choice; it represents a commitment to innovation and improved efficiency in our increasingly digital world.